Begin by entering your name as shown on your income tax return in the designated field. If you have a business name, include it in the 'Business name' section.
Select the appropriate box that describes your entity type: Individual, Sole Proprietor, Corporation, Partnership, or Other.
Fill in your address, including street number, apartment or suite number, city, state, and ZIP code.
Provide your Taxpayer Identification Number (TIN). For individuals, this is typically your Social Security Number (SSN). Ensure it matches the name provided to avoid backup withholding.
If applicable, indicate if you are exempt from backup withholding by checking the relevant box in Part II.
Read and complete the certification section. Sign and date the form where indicated to validate your information.

Who needs to fill out a W-9 form? Employers who work with independent contractors must provide them with a W-9 form to fill out before starting work. There are specific criteria for who is classified as an independent contractor and will need to fill it out.
What is a W9 form for?
Use Form W-9 to provide your correct Taxpayer Identification Number (TIN) to the person who is required to file an information return with the IRS to report, for example: Income paid to you. Real estate transactions. Mortgage interest you paid.
What is the difference between a 1099 and a w9?

Do I have to pay taxes if I fill out a W9?
However, simply filling out a W-9 doesnt require a person to pay taxes. These payments arent typically subjected to IRS withholding, meaning it is the payees responsibility to track their income and pay the necessary taxes.
